Background
The world today is facing the devastating COVID-19 health crisis that has posed a global risk in all economies. This has undoubtedly necessitated the critical need for preparedness and implementation of sustainable health across all health systems. Over the past decades, the African health system has faced significant challenges in sustaining health care delivery which has, unfortunately, been worsened by the COVID-19 pandemic.
A report from the World Health Organization shows that ­the consolidated average system performance index in the Africa region is 0.49, implying that systems are only performing at 49% of their possible levels of functionality. Countries’ performance scores range from 0.26 and 0.70. All the indices for the performance dimensions are underperforming, with system resilience and access to essential services doing worst.
Sustainable global health entails a careful adoption of innovative strategies committed to improving the lives of people, safeguarding individuals, and improving the community’s well-being. It involves providing preventive care systems adapted to the evolving health challenges of today and the future. Therefore, achieving a sustainable healthy Africa is very crucial to the development of African economies. It is against this framework that the Health Policy and Research Division of the Nkafu Policy Institute lodged at the Denis and Lenora Foretia Foundation is organizing this forum.
About the Nkafu Africa Health Forum (NAHF)
The Nkafu Africa Health Forum offers an exclusive, up-to-date view of the major opportunities and challenges affecting the health sector in Africa. By pooling together the brightest minds from across the continent and associating key governmental and non-governmental stakeholders, the NAHF is poised to make its mark on Africa’s drive toward modernization of its health sector and attaining universal health coverage.
The 2-day forum will highlight some of the most pressing issues and engage experts to discuss and develop an agenda for cross-border collaboration in view of giving the African health sector a much-deserved facelift. Also, on display at this forum will be success stories, startups, innovations, and ground-breaking abstracts relevant to health sector development in post-COVID-19 Africa.
Objectives of NAHF
The 2-day forum will spotlight key health issues on the continent and showcase how new research and innovation can transform the healthcare industry on the continent. This forum shall propose concise, purposeful, and futuristic evidence-based policies that are critical to advancing sustainable global health in Africa amid the COVID-19 pandemic to circumvent the devastating health, social and economic regression.
